The Kenya Red cross Training institute is now fully accredited and registered by the Kenya National qualification authority.
This milestone will go a long way To enhance uniformity and equality in the Education sector.
The institute was okeyed after having fulfilled the Kenya National Qualifications Framework guidelines.
The Ag. DG Alice Kandie lauded the KRCTI for being registered into the KNQF noting the critical role it plays in the health sector hence the need to have credible qualifications for the health workers
